Moflash Buzzer, 90dB, 230 V AC - AE20M Series - AE20M-230


This compact piezo buzzer from Moflash is ideal as a warning signal for industrial and commercial applications. It works by using a piezo crystal to push a diaphragm, generating a pressure wave that produces sound. As the buzzer consumes just 25mA of current, it's an energy-efficient choice. You can choose between a continuous or a pulsing tone, depending on your needs.

Features and Benefits


• Base made of ABS (acrylonitrile butadiene styrene) plastic for resistance to impact and corrosion
• Produces 90dB (decibels) of sound for a highly audible warning signal
• IP55 (ingress protection) rating for resistance to dust and low-pressure water jets
• Wide operating temperature range of -25°C to +55°C for use in demanding conditions
• Compact diameter of 43mm for use in panels with limited space

How do I use this buzzer safely?


This buzzer produces sound waves from the oscillation of the piezoelectric diaphragm via a sound emission hole, meaning it's not sealed from the environment. This means you should be sure not to close the hole and remove obstacles within 15mm on the front side of the casing.
